Common Stonework Repair Jobs
Stone veneer repair - restoring the appearance and stability of existing stone veneer surfaces.
Cracked stone replacement - removing damaged stones and replacing them to maintain structural integrity.
Mortar joint restoration - repointing and sealing mortar joints to prevent water infiltration.
Stone step repair - fixing cracks or chips in stone steps for safety and aesthetic appeal.
Retaining wall repair - addressing stability issues and restoring functionality of stone retaining walls.
Surface cleaning and sealing - cleaning stone surfaces and applying sealants to protect against weathering.
Stonework Repair Questions
What types of stonework repairs are commonly requested? Common repairs include fixing cracked or chipped stones, restoring damaged mortar joints, and replacing broken or missing stones to maintain structural integrity and appearance.
How can I tell if my stonework need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, loose stones, uneven surfaces, or mortar deterioration that affects the stability or aesthetics of the structure.
What materials are used in stonework repair? Repairs typically involve matching existing stone and mortar materials to ensure consistency and durability in the restored area.
Is stonework repair suitable for historic properties? Yes, specialized techniques can be used to preserve the historic character while addressing structural issues effectively.
